Chunky Beef Chili
Total Time: 3 hrs 45 mins
Preparation Time: 45 mins
Cook Time: 3 hrs
Ingredients
- Servings: 10
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 6 lbs beef chuck, cut into 1 . 5 inch cubes
- salt and pepper
- 2 medium onions, chopped
- 2 green peppers, chopped
- 2 jalapenos, finely chopped
- 6 garlic cloves, finely chopped
- 2 tablespoons chili powder
- 1 tablespoon ground cumin
- 1 tablespoon dried oregano
- 1 (14 1/2 ounce) can diced tomatoes
- 1 (14 1/2 ounce) can reduced-sodium beef broth
- 1 (12 ounce) bottle lager beer
- 4 cups cooked pinto beans (optional) or 4 cups canned pinto beans (optional) or 4 cups canned kidney beans (optional)
- 1/4 cup yellow cornmeal
- 1 ounce unsweetened chocolate, finely chopped
Recipe
- 1 heat the oil in a large dutch oven over high heat. season beef with salt and pepper and brown beef in batches, without crowding pot. transfer browned beef to bowl or platter.
- 2 add onions, green peppers and jalapenos to pot and cook, stirring often, until soft, about 5 minutes.
- 3 add garlic to pot and cook veggies one minute more.
- 4 sprinkle veggies with chili powder, cumin and oregeno. stir weel.
- 5 return beef and any juices to pot. stir in tomatoes with their juice, broth and beer.
- 6 bring to a boil. reduce heat to medium-low and cover pot. simmer until meat is tender, about 2 hours.
- 7 remove from heat and let cool a few minutes. skim off surface fat. stir in cooked beans, if desired.
- 8 remove one cup of chili liquid and mix well with cornmeal. stir the cornmeal paste into pot along with chocolate. cook until thickens slightly, about 5 more minutes.
- 9 serve with sour cream, shredded cheddar and chopped green onions, if desired.
